Be Impeccable With Your Word
One of my favorite books is The Four Agreements by Don Miguel Ruiz. It is also a favorite of one of my coaching clients. Together we are exploring the agreements in our coaching sessions. Although I have read the book many times, I am seeing so much more this time around. We just finished the first agreement - be impeccable with your word. I was just amazed at how I now see the beauty and importance of not just keeping my word to others but to myself. I now see the importance of refraining from finding fault with myself-to only speak loving things about myself. I am learning to quiet that taunting voice that wants to make me wrong or make me feel bad about myself. I also never realized how the other agreements are so dependent on this first agreement. Being impeccable with my word has me loving and accepting myself more which I know ultimately has me loving and accepting others more, just as they are. If you have not read the book or have not picked it up lately, it would be a great summer read by the pool.
